Materials
- White on white fabric for the embroidery squares
- Stranded cotton in red, light green, gold and pink
- Fabric scraps for border and sashing
- Embellishments and ribbon
- Quilt batting
- Fabric for the back
Embroidery
Pick any four of the words from my Christmas quilt and draw a few leaves and flowers around the letters as per photos below.
Trim the embroidery to 4.5inches.
Border
Cut 2 inch stripes of fabric and assemble as per picture below.
Make a quilt sandwich with the top, the batting and the backing fabric and stitch around the inside border only.
Binding
The binding is double folded. Cut 2 stripes of fabric 1.5 inch wide, fold in half and iron. Attach to the wall hanging with mitered corners.made out of one long 1.5 inch stripe folded in half.
Embellish with self covered buttons, fabric flowers sequins and the like.
Iron the wall hanging well so that it hangs straight.
Ready to hang on the wall!
